We are seeking an enthusiastic, team-oriented Registered Veterinary Nurse to join our team at Barrow Hill Veterinary Hospital on a full-time or part-time basis. Barrow Hill Veterinary Centre is a purpose-built, multi-site practice based in Ashford, Kent, with branches in New Romney and Hythe. Our teams work across all four sites, with out-of-hours care supported by nearby VetsNow, helping to maintain a strong work-life balance. We are well equipped with modern facilities, including digital and dental X-ray, CT scanning, endoscopy, orthopaedic equipment, and a K-laser, alongside dedicated dog, cat, and isolation wards. We are also entering an exciting phase of development, with a planned refurbishment to further enhance our Ashford site. Our culture is supportive and collaborative, with a strong focus on CPD, clinical excellence, and staff wellbeing. We hold regular clinical discussions and actively promote a healthy, sustainable working environment. Ideally located in Ashford, we are close to the coast, Eurotunnel, Canterbury, and excellent transport links via Ashford International.

How You’ll Make a Difference
As a Registered Veterinary Nurse, you will be an integral member of the clinical team, delivering high-quality nursing care to patients while supporting excellent client experiences. You’ll work collaboratively with veterinary surgeons and the wider practice team, taking responsibility for the nursing care of a range of first opinion cases, contributing to clinical standards, and supporting the ongoing development of patient care within the practice. We’re pleased to consider both full-time and part-time applications for this role. A typical full-time role comprises either 4 x 10-hour days or 5 x 8-hour days at your preference between the hours of 08:00-20:00, after which our out-of-hours cases are transferred to VetsNow. You will also participate in a 1:4 Saturday rota, with a weekday off in lieu where applicable.
General responsibilities include:
- Carrying out nurse clinics
- Supporting the wider clinical team across kennel duties, theatre assistance, and surgical procedures
- Dispensing medication accurately and in line with clinical protocols
- Delivering attentive inpatient care and monitoring patients closely throughout their time with us
